The “Unhinged Home Design” meme was sparked by the satirical home renovation animation videos popular on TikTok, such as those of Home Design 369 and Designer Bob. These videos are often trippy and feature absurdist animations, such as heads floating through ceilings or pet tigers pouncing around. These video clips have become a meme in their own right, and are a great way to lighten the mood during a decorating project.
